The Illawarra will hold on to the Creighton Cup after the final was washed out for a second-straight year on Sunday.

Jamie Fleming's side was to play South Coast in the decider at Figtree Oval. The rain, however, proved too heavy, preventing the teams from taking the field.
The wash out came after both of Saturday's semi-finals were abandoned.
Rhys Voysey and Eric Denhartog combined to reduce Shoalhaven to 5-42 before the two sides shook hands.
South Coast and Highlands had more luck, however they were ultimately forced off as well.
Brynley Richards' side was 1-48 in response to Highlands 176 when the match was abandoned.
The Creighton Cup was to form the primary selection trial for the Greater Illawarra Zone Country Championships squad.
A team is likely to be announced this week.
The Country tournament will be held in Goulburn on November 20-22.
